Who is The Apprentice candidate Charles Burns?

Charles Burns was a 24 years old management consultant and luxury watch trader living in Manchester when he entered The Apprentice series 13 in 2017.

He was born in April 1993 in Britain.

Charles started off in the family business Burns Jewellers Group, set up by his great grandfather Joel in 1958.

Charles Burns, who is Jewish, was educated at Manchester Grammar School and King David High School.

He is in a relationship with Alyx Glazer and is good friends with Serge Fagelman.

Charles Burns had a lucky escape in week one of The Apprentice, when he was brought back into the boardroom by the losing project manager Danny Grant.

Lord Sugar called Charles disruptive, but ended up firing Danny instead.

Along with Andrew Brady, and Anisa Topan, Charles Burns was fired in the eighth week of The Apprentice.
